Predictive analysis may possibly require data mining, which happens to be the process of finding interesting or helpful patterns in large volumes of information. Data mining often involves cluster analysis, which tries to discover organic groupings within just data, and anomaly detection, which detects circumstances in data which might be abnormal and jump out from other patterns. It could also look for principles in datasets, powerful interactions amongst variables while in the data.
